Output e3deebf6a0a85743e449405a1cfbe84b72543486b4244d3cf93db89d2a5ebc99:22

value
5150400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53aa649687b27c65a8a9ceb2358a32181420179b OP_EQUAL
address
MFXYSTdHqvP1wTakTN6v5fgtfd2bGeih92
transaction
e3deebf6a0a85743e449405a1cfbe84b72543486b4244d3cf93db89d2a5ebc99
spent
true